Hassilabied is a hidden gem in the heart of the Moroccan Sahara, renowned for its lush oasis and traditional Berber culture. This serene destination offers a unique blend of desert landscapes, palm groves, and ancient kasbahs, providing an authentic Sahara experience away from the tourist crowds.
The lush Hassilabied Oasis is the heart of the region, offering a stark contrast to the surrounding desert. Visitors can explore the palm groves, enjoy the tranquility, and experience the traditional Berber way of life.
This ancient fortified village, or ksar, offers a glimpse into the region's past. The ksar features traditional Berber architecture, including mud-brick buildings and defensive walls.
Explore the stunning desert landscapes surrounding Hassilabied on a guided tour. Options include camel trekking, 4x4 excursions, and overnight stays in traditional desert camps.

The best time to visit Hassilabied is during the cooler months, when temperatures are pleasant and suitable for exploring the oasis and surrounding desert. This period offers ideal conditions for outdoor activities and cultural experiences.
